i386: Fix up expander conditions on cbranchbf4 and cstorebf4 [PR107969]

  Hi!

With -msoft-float we ICE on __bf16 comparisons, because the
insns we want to use under the hood (cbranchsf4 and cstoresf4)
after performing the fast extensions aren't available.

The following patch copies the conditions from the c*sf4 expanders
to the corresponding c*bf4 expanders.

Bootstrapped/regtested on x86_64-linux and i686-linux, ok for trunk?

2022-12-06  Jakub Jelinek  <jakub@redhat.com>

	PR target/107969
	* config/i386/i386.md (cbranchbf4, cstorebf4): Guard expanders
	with the same condition as cbranchsf4 or cstoresf4 expanders.

	* gcc.target/i386/pr107969.c: New test.

Patch

--- gcc/config/i386/i386.md.jj	2022-12-02 10:28:30.000000000 +0100
+++ gcc/config/i386/i386.md	2022-12-05 17:21:53.062085995 +0100
@@ -1667,7 +1667,7 @@  (define_expand "cbranchbf4"
 		(const_int 0)])
 	      (label_ref (match_operand 3))
 	      (pc)))]
-  ""
+  "TARGET_80387 || (SSE_FLOAT_MODE_P (SFmode) && TARGET_SSE_MATH)"
 {
   rtx op1 = ix86_expand_fast_convert_bf_to_sf (operands[1]);
   rtx op2 = ix86_expand_fast_convert_bf_to_sf (operands[2]);
@@ -1702,7 +1702,7 @@  (define_expand "cstorebf4"
 	(match_operator 1 "comparison_operator"
 	  [(reg:CC FLAGS_REG)
 	   (const_int 0)]))]
-  ""
+  "TARGET_80387 || (SSE_FLOAT_MODE_P (SFmode) && TARGET_SSE_MATH)"
 {
   rtx op1 = ix86_expand_fast_convert_bf_to_sf (operands[2]);
   rtx op2 = ix86_expand_fast_convert_bf_to_sf (operands[3]);
--- gcc/testsuite/gcc.target/i386/pr107969.c.jj	2022-12-05 17:27:36.229060068 +0100
+++ gcc/testsuite/gcc.target/i386/pr107969.c	2022-12-05 17:27:14.839373669 +0100
@@ -0,0 +1,12 @@ 
+/* PR target/107969 */
+/* { dg-do compile } */
+/* { dg-options "-O2 -fexcess-precision=16 -msoft-float -msse2" } */
+
+int i;
+__bf16 f;
+
+void
+bar (void)
+{
+  i *= 0 <= f;
+}
